Manoeuvrability

A 3 wheeler pushchair off road wheeled pushchair is an excellent option for parents seeking a more maneuverable pushchair. These pushchairs have two small wheels in the front and one large wheel at the back making them easier to navigate and navigate through narrow spaces. This makes them ideal for city walks, shopping trips, and traversing through busy streets.

There are many options available on the market regardless of whether you're looking for 3-wheel pushchairs for a stroll through the park or for a family day out. Consider your lifestyle and where you plan to use the pushchair prior to making a choice. This will help you find the perfect pushchair for your needs.

A lot of 3-wheeled pushchairs are able to handle various terrains, including rough surfaces and bumpy road. They are typically fitted with large, puncture resistant tyres and a good suspension to ensure your baby's safety. Some of them even have the option to connect an infant car seat which makes them a great option for families who frequently go on outdoor excursions.

A 3-wheeled all-terrain stroller is a popular alternative. It is able to handle many different terrains and is perfect for long walks in the country. Many of these pushchairs come with a sling that is made of fabric, and can be used as early as birth with the carrycot included. There are also features such as adjustable handles and a rain cover and a large storage basket.

Lastly, there are also 3-wheeler pushchairs that function as 4 wheelers, but with two small front wheels placed close together (in the same way that traditional '4 wheelers' feature two wheels on the front). This provides them with the stability and maneuverability of a 3 wheel stroller and car seat-wheel pushchair while still offering you some extra convenience.

Stability

A three-wheeled pushchair can provide stability that four-wheeled models don't have. They can also be more comfortable to ride for your baby. This is especially true for the most expensive models because they are typically equipped with suspension and larger wheels. Some models have a front wheel that can be locked and swivels giving you more stability when on rough terrain.

If you intend to use your pushchair in urban settings, choose a model with moulded wheels that are suitable for paved roads and tracks. This will provide your child with a an easier ride than a pushchair with wheels that are clogged up with dirt and other debris. If you intend to take it off-road as well make sure you choose an option with tyres that are filled with air that can withstand the most surfaces including sand and mud. These tyres are also referred to as pneumatics, and can be seen on some buggies designed to work in rural or urban environments.

Many all-terrain pushchairs are made to be used on rough, bumpy and uneven ground, ranging from sandy beaches to woodland trails. They usually come with a special suspension large puncture-proof tyres, as well as seats that are extra cushioned. Look for features such as adjustable suspension, the ability to change tyres as well as an easy-to-use front wheel lockable that can be used for crossing especially difficult terrain.

Some all-terrain pushchairs are also designed to work with a range of different seating options for children such as infant carriers and carrycots to toddler seats and car seats. The UPPAbaby, for example is compatible with its own car seat, as also with third-party brands. It has a world-facing unit that can also be reversed to face forward. It also has a quick fold with one hand and foam-filled tyres that never flatten.

Weight

Compared with a standard pushchair, all-terrain models can be quite heavy. The main reason for this is the huge rear wheels. However some brands, such as UPPAbaby produce lightweight models with foam-filled tyres that never flatten and have excellent suspension. The UPPAbaby Ridge has a number of characteristics that make it perfect for off-road use, such as a large basket, adjustable handlebar, and a single hand fold.

The huge rear wheels of all-terrain strollers can make them quite wide. This could be an issue for those who live in the city and walk through narrow streets or go to the shops frequently. Off-road capabilities

3-wheel prams, which are designed for outdoor terrains, are ideal for rough surfaces like gravel paths and sand. The hard-wearing tires are suitable for all weather conditions. They can be used in rain, sun and snow. They can easily be converted into a travel system by attaching a car-seat.

The latest Maxi-Cosi 3-wheeler which is best known for their car seats, is the Stella stroller that is all-terrain. It is suitable for babies from birth, and comes with a carrycot that can hold up to 22kg. It has air-filled tires and an easy one-handed fold.

The Goodbaby Maris Jogger is another great alternative. It's a stunning stroller that comes with professional bike tires from Schwalbe. This pushchair is suitable for all terrains and especially rough terrains. It folds easily in one hand and is suitable for both rearward and front facing.
